The crypto market witnessed a major milestone as Canary Capital officially launched the
$XRP ETF on November 13, 2025, marking one of the most successful ETF debuts in the industry. With a massive $59 million trading volume on Day 1 and $256 million within the first three days, the XRP ETF quickly became the top ETF launch of 2025, reinforcing strong institutional interest despite overall market turbulence.
This launch also symbolized a historic moment for Ripple, following its long-fought legal battle with the SEC. The final ruling acted as a confidence boost for the XRP community and institutions that have stood with Ripple throughout the case.
ETF Hype vs Market Reality: Why XRP Price Dropped Instead of Rising
On November 24, 2025, the crypto world buzzed with two major announcements:
The official launch of the
$XRP ETFThe introduction of Grayscale’s Dogecoin ETFWhile investors expected XRP to rally strongly, reality unfolded differently.
Instead of pumping, XRP fell from $2.50 to $2.00, surprising many traders.
Why did this happen?
1. Classic “Sell the News” Behavior
On-chain data revealed that whales sold nearly 200 million XRP in the first 48 hours after the ETF launch.
This selling pressure overpowered institutional inflows, causing downward volatility instead of the expected pump.
2. Negative Overall Market Sentiment
The broader crypto market experienced a $1.1 trillion drop in total market cap within 41 days.
Bitcoin slipped under the $90,000 level, dragging major altcoins — including XRP — along with it.
3. ETF Effects Take Time
Experts note that new ETF inflows rarely impact prices instantly.
Historically, the strongest price effects emerge months later, meaning 2026 could be the real turning point for XRP ETF–driven growth.
On-Chain Data Shows Market Weakness
Even at a price of $2.10, around 41.5% of XRP’s circulating supply remained held at a loss.
This indicates:
A large number of late buyers stuck in high-entry positions
Continued profit-taking pressure
A structurally weak market setup for short-term movements
This explains why XRP couldn’t maintain bullish momentum despite the groundbreaking ETF launch.
